1927 Babe Ruth & Lou Gehrig Barnstorming Program
<B>1927 Babe Ruth & Lou Gehrig Barnstorming Program.</B></I> Forget the circus--the greatest show on earth in the Fall of 1927 was headlined by these titans of the Bronx, who took their baseball theatrics on the road in the weeks following their four-game World Series sweep of the Pittsburgh Pirates. Presented here is an exceedingly rare souvenir program from the duo's Sunday, October 23, 1927 appearance at Oakland (CA) Baseball Park, issued as the Yankee teammates faced off as leaders of the "Busting Babes" and "Larruping Lou's" respectively. A classic photographic portrait of the season's Home Run King and its Most Valuable Player on the cover gives way to a partially pencil-marked scorecard at center. It's interesting to note that the Babe is listed in the batting line-up as occupying first base, perhaps fed up with all of the running required of him as the Yanks' right fielder. Joining Gehrig in the Larruping Lous dugout was fellow Yankee Hall of Famer Tony Lazzeri, batting sixth. A forty-eight star American flag adorns the rear cover. A moderate degree of expected wear is noted in the form of corner chipping, mild toning and about one inch of separation of the eleven inch spine.
